Bealls to Accept Crypto In-Store via Flexa Across 660+ U.S. Locations

The rollout uses Flexa Payments to plug cryptocurrency support directly into existing checkout systems.

Overview

  • Bealls announced on Oct. 20 that it will enable cryptocurrency payments at more than 660 stores in 22 states through a partnership with Flexa.
  • Flexa Payments will allow customers to pay with Bitcoin, Ethereum, Dogecoin, USDC and other tokens using over 300 supported wallets.
  • The capability will also be available at Home Centric, the home goods chain operated by Bealls.
  • Bealls says it is the first national retailer to accept crypto from any wallet across more than a dozen blockchain networks.
  • Flexa says its system integrates directly with point-of-sale infrastructure and provides sub-second settlement for in-store transactions.
